What is the Arkansas Boat Bill of Sale form?
The Arkansas Boat Bill of Sale form is a document used to record the sale or transfer of ownership of a boat in the state of Arkansas. This form provides essential details about the transaction, including information about the buyer, the seller, and the boat itself. It serves as proof of the sale and can be important for registration and tax purposes.
Why do I need a Boat Bill of Sale?
A Boat Bill of Sale is crucial for several reasons. First, it protects both the buyer and seller by documenting the transaction. This form helps establish ownership, which is necessary for registering the boat with the state. Additionally, it can be used to resolve any disputes that may arise after the sale.
What information is required on the form?
The form typically requires specific information, including the names and addresses of both the buyer and seller, the boat's make, model, year, and hull identification number (HIN). It should also include the sale price and the date of the transaction. Some forms may require signatures from both parties to validate the sale.
Is the Boat Bill of Sale form mandatory in Arkansas?
While it is not legally required to have a Boat Bill of Sale in Arkansas, it is highly recommended. Without this document, proving ownership can become difficult, especially during registration or if any legal issues arise. Having a signed bill of sale provides clarity and security for both parties involved in the transaction.
Can I create my own Boat Bill of Sale?
Yes, you can create your own Boat Bill of Sale, as long as it includes all necessary information. However, using a standard form ensures that you include all required details and follow any specific state guidelines. Many online resources offer templates that you can customize to fit your needs.
What should I do after completing the Boat Bill of Sale?
After completing the Boat Bill of Sale, both the buyer and seller should keep a copy for their records. The buyer will need the form to register the boat with the Arkansas Game and Fish Commission. It's also wise to submit a copy to your local tax office to ensure proper tax assessment.
